In 1962, after the death of the
Cartier brothers, the company was
divided into three parts and sold to
owners in Paris, London and New
York. After 10 years, the company
was reunited.
In 1972, Cartier started the mass
production of watches in Switzerland
at their acquired watchmaking
enterprise. In 2014, the watch
brand Cartier was valued at 2.9
billion Swiss francs, which put it at
third place among brands of Swiss
watches.
With the formation of Les Must de
Cartier in 1973, Cartier boutiques
were opened in more than 20
countries. The largest boutiques
are located in New York, Milan,
Beverly Hills, Rome, Boston, San
Francisco, Tokyo, Paris, Shanghai
and Vancouver.
The House has boutiques in
Russia and other CIS countries –
Azerbaijan, Kazakhstan, Ukraine.
